CBD Tincture is also referred to as “Drops” by various manufacturers. The terms Tincture and Drops can be used interchangeably. No matter what you call them, they provide the advantage of rapid bioavailability. That means it is fast-acting.
The percentage or fraction of an administered serving of CBD or CBG that has an active effect after it enters the bloodstream is referred to as bioavailability.
Because some of the CDB or CBG goes almost directly into your bloodstream, there is a limited loss of potency. If the serving is a theoretical 500mg of CBD, work under the assumption that approximately 12% – 35% of that 500mg of CBD will be utilized.
CBD Wellness Tincture Products, Some of the Basics
The optimal manner to administer a CBD Oil Tincture is sublingual. Use the dropper to place the tincture under your tongue and hold it there for 30 – 90 seconds, then swallow. That will increase the bioavailability of CBD, CBD, CBN, and CBDA that gets absorbed into your bloodstream.
Because you administer tinctures sub-lingually, a larger percentage gets into your bloodstream. This is not necessarily the case with capsules or edibles. In any CBD substance that is ingested the bioavailability is generally anywhere from 6% – 20%.
There are exceptions that will be explained in a more thorough treatment of bioavailability that will be covered in an upcoming In-depth Article.
Though not quite as convenient as a CBD capsule, gummy, or energy bar, Tinctures are still easy to transport, carry, and use. Because they are frequently flavored, Tinctures can be very pleasant tasting. Even the unflavored Tinctures at their least flavorful still taste OK.


CBD Oil Tinctures are available as;
- Full-spectrum (less than 0.3% THC)
- Broad-spectrum (THC-Free)
- CBD or CBG Isolate (THC-Free).
Either a simple spray or a few drops under your tongue should be enough to feel the full effects of soothing high-grade CBD or CBG.
You can also mix CBD oIL Tinctures with a glass of juice or a smoothie. You won’t have the same high level of bioavailability, but you’ll still get a more than reasonable amount of CBD or CBG in your system.
CBD Wellness Tincture Complexities
If you’ve never used CBD Tinctures, keep in mind, that they can be very potent. It’s best to start with the smallest possible serving. Once you start to feel the effects of CBD you can easily increase your serving or the frequency of servings until you get the desired results.
CBD and CBG have multiple positive benefits including; stress reduction, reduced inflammation, and pain relief. It’s important to point out that the FDA has not yet approved the use of CBD and CBG for pain relief of any type.
